The Pacific Region Ferrari Club has invited TrackMasters Racing members
to
particpate in the 2004 running of the Virginia City Hill Climb.(between
Reno
and Carson City, Nevada) The Ferrari club is the only group allowed to
run
this event, and has been doing so successfully for many years.
The Hill Climb at Virginia City, held September 17,18,& 19 this year,
is now
in its 30th year. This 3-day event is the Ferrari Clubs most popular
one and
is always sold out. The road from Silver City up to Virginia City is
5.2
miles long with 20 + turns and an elevation change of 1200 feet.
Normally,
100 Ferrari's and Shelby’s show up to drive the hill for 2 full days
with a
celebratory banquet on Sunday night.
The hill climb is a timed event, so as long as your car is started in
the
correct class, you may only encounter a few cars on the way up the
hill. My
understanding is that the car you enter must be street legal and
licensed.

If you want to watch, there's a good spot at the top of the hill but you'll need to hike out about 100 yds. Go up by the sheriff's station at the top of that road (341 I think is the truck route), and hike out (southeast) to the point. You can see the top 3rd of the course, probably 6 or 7 turns worth of the road.
